The digital transformation era has revolutionized how businesses operate, introducing advanced technologies that streamline processes and enhance productivity. However, as organizations embrace these innovations, ensuring robust security measures becomes paramount to protect sensitive data and maintain trust.
Cyber threats are evolving rapidly, and with the increasing reliance on digital platforms, businesses are more vulnerable than ever. A breach can lead to devastating financial losses, reputational damage, and legal repercussions. Therefore, implementing a comprehensive security strategy is not just an option; it's a necessity.
To navigate the complexities of digital transformation while safeguarding enterprise data, organizations should consider the following strategies:
Regular security assessments help identify vulnerabilities within the existing IT infrastructure. Conducting penetration tests and audits allows businesses to address potential weaknesses before they can be exploited by malicious actors.
Employing advanced cybersecurity tools, such as next-generation firewalls and intrusion detection systems, can significantly enhance protection against cyber threats. These technologies provide real-time monitoring and quick response capabilities to mitigate risks.
Employee training and awareness are crucial in combating cyber threats. By fostering a security-first culture, organizations can ensure that all employees understand their role in maintaining security and follow best practices to protect sensitive information.
Cloud technology has become integral to digital transformation, offering scalability and flexibility. However, integrating cloud solutions must be approached with caution. Selecting reputable cloud service providers that prioritize security is essential, as well as employing encryption for sensitive data stored in the cloud.
Encrypting data at rest and in transit is a fundamental practice to protect sensitive information. It ensures that even if data is intercepted, it remains unreadable without the proper decryption keys.
Outdated software is a common entry point for cybercriminals. Organizations should establish a routine for updating software and systems to patch vulnerabilities and enhance security features.
In conclusion, as businesses continue to embrace digital transformation, prioritizing enterprise security is critical. By implementing comprehensive strategies and leveraging advanced technologies, organizations can build a resilient security framework that protects their data and supports sustainable growth.
